15 year old male travel soccer player collapsed onto field during competition.  Spectator pediatrician Dr. Rebecca Newman of Glenview dashed onto field to help.  She reported no femoral pulse/no carotid pulse and began chest compressions.  Former firefighter Athletico Center General Manager Dana Plotkin (CPR/AED certified) performed m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, and Operations Director Tania Nightingale (CPR/AED certified) applied AED delivering 3 shocks.  

Northbrook Fire Rescue was summoned and took over CPR/AED upon arrival.  Patient was transported by ambulance to Glenbrook Hospital, and then, to Lutheran General Pediatric ICU.
